Output 38099021c66b7de8f0663b3df26abcf2fd54db5cb72a7a7b4994414563b81a4a:1

value
3387404
script pubkey
OP_0 OP_PUSHBYTES_20 8e67188914c61c5f0b38e1e04329d1609f3e46f6
address
ltc1q3en33zg5ccw97zecu8syx2w3vz0nu3hklh0jtg
transaction
38099021c66b7de8f0663b3df26abcf2fd54db5cb72a7a7b4994414563b81a4a
spent
true